Customized fixtures ultimately increase the visual appeal of bathrooms and satisfy individual preferences, converting spaces into true personal sanctuaries.Regularly Posed QuestionsWhat Is the Mean Cost of a Bathroom Upgrade in 2026?In 2026, the median cost of a bathroom upgrade ranges from $10,000 to $25,000, relying on aspects like proportions, finishes, and the extent of renovations, reflecting varying tastes and budgets across householders.How much time Does a Typical Bathroom Remodeling Project Take?A routine bathroom reconstruction endeavor normally lasts between four to six weeks, contingent upon the scope of work. Considerations including design complexity, contractor availability schedules, and material availability can alter the overall timeline remarkably.What Licenses Are Needed for Bathroom Renovation?In most cases, obtaining a permit is mandatory for bathroom renovations, especially when pipes, electrical, or structural alterations are involved. Homeowners should check local regulations to confirm compliance and steer clear of likely fines or work holdups.How Can I Find the Ideal Service Provider for My Project?To choose the suitable contractor, one should examine certifications, review ratings, check references, and compile multiple proposals. Plain communication about goals and timelines and schedules is essential for ensuring a positive partnership across the renovation process.What Are the Most Widespread Oversights to Circumvent in Bathroom Remodeling?Prevalent oversights in bathroom renovation involve deficient planning, omitting set a budget, overlooking ventilation, ignoring water line difficulties, and selecting trendy finishes over timeless utility.
